Ingredients
Scale
- 8 oz (225g) cream cheese, softened
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- ½ cup heavy cream
- ½ tsp vanilla extract
- 1 tbsp all-purpose flour (or cornstarch for a gluten-free version)
- ¼ tsp salt
Instructions
Step 1: Prepare Your Oven and Loaf Pan
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Line a 9×5-inch loaf pan with parchment paper, leaving extra hanging over the edges to make removal easy.
Step 2: Make the Cheesecake Batter
- In a large bowl, beat the cream cheese and sugar together until smooth and creamy (about 2 minutes).
- Add the eggs one at a time, beating after each addition.
- Mix in the heavy cream, vanilla, flour (or cornstarch), and salt, stirring until just combined.
Step 3: Pour and Bake
-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an, smoothing the top with a spatula.
- Bake for 45-50 minutes, until the top is deep golden brown and slightly cracked. The center should still jiggle slightly when shaken.
Step 4: Cool and Serve
- Let the cheesecake cool in the pan for 1 hour, then refrigerate for at least 2 hours (or overnight) for the best texture.
- Once fully set, remove from the pan using the parchment paper and slice into thick, creamy pieces.
Step 5: Enjoy!
Serve at room temperature or chilled, with a dusting of powdered sugar or fresh berries.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cooling Time: 2 hours (or overnight)
- Cook Time: 45-50 minutes
